On Quantitizing [PDF]

open access: yesJournal of Mixed Methods Research, 2009
Quantitizing, commonly understood to refer to the numerical translation, transformation, or conversion of qualitative data, has become a staple of mixed methods research. Typically glossed are the foundational assumptions, judgments, and compromises involved in converting disparate data sets into each other and whether such conversions advance inquiry.

Quantitative languages [PDF]

open access: yesACM Transactions on Computational Logic, 2008
Quantitative generalizations of classical languages, which assign to each word a real number instead of a Boolean value, have applications in modeling resource-constrained computation.
